They say that things improve with age, and at McCorquodale we wouldn’t disagree. Ever since George McCorquodale opened our first factory in Wolverton in 1878, we’ve been delivering high quality printed materials, constantly learning and developing new techniques, adapting to the changing needs of our industry and living by the same values the company was founded on. Good old-fashioned values such as high quality, good all round value and a personal service. Values that mean as much today as they did 130 years ago.
Starting as being a letterpress printer, a confidential printer for The Royal Mint and the Government, through to forms, envelopes, direct mail, packaging and litho and digital printing, there are very few print jobs we cannot handle.
